Hardhead Catfish

Appearance: Brownish to gray-green. White to yellowish below. Fin spines with no fleshy filaments. Barbel at corner of mouth not very flattened and shorter than head. Four barbels on chin.

Habitat: Continental waters; enters brackish waters. Commonly caught from bridges, catwalks, and piers, particularly in passes and inland waterways.

State Record: 3lb, 5oz.
